Proviso East coach Aaron Peppers only needed a few words to sum up how his team played on Friday night.
"We had our lunch handed to us," Peppers said. No argument there.
Proviso East (1-5, 1-2) can forget about the state playoffs after a 42-6 loss to Downers Grove South (4-2, 3-0) in a West Suburban Conference Gold Division game.
The game was decided quickly after Downers South scored touchdowns on its opening four possessions to build a 28-0 lead at halftime.
Downers South quarterback Chandler Whitmer, who has orally committed to play next season at Illinois, threw a pair of touchdown passes to Reggie Miller of 30 and 25 yards. Miller also had an 8-yard touchdown run. Whitmer added another TD pass on a 53-yard toss to Ryan Oruche.
The only scoring opportunity for Proviso East in the first half came after an interception by linebacker Phillip Wells with 16.6 seconds to play in the second quarter. Wells returned the ball 68 yards to the Downers South 23.
Whitmer made the tackle to keep Wells out of the end zone. The drive stalled on a third-down incomplete pass in the end zone as the first half ended.
The Pirates were unsuccessful on four fourth-down plays in an attempt to move the chains and keep possession in the opening 24 minutes.
Oruche scored on runs of 6 and 4 yards in the third quarter to give Downers South a 42-0 lead with 5 minutes, 32 seconds on the clock. The Pirates avoided a shutout thanks to a 6-yard run by Darnell Swanigan on the final play of the third quarter.
